All Trailer Hitches Complaints

#11519511 |
The contact owns a 2020 Kia Telluride. The contact received notification of NHTSA Campaign Number: 22V626 (Trailer Hitches) however, the part to do the recall repair was not yet available. The contact stated that the manufacturer had exceeded a reasonable amount of time for the recall repair. The dealer was made aware of the issue. The manufacturer was not made aware of the issue. The contact had not experienced a failure. Parts distribution disconnect.
#11506584 | Fire
The contact owned a 2020 Kia Telluride. The contact stated that after getting off the freeway, the vehicle behind him informed him that there was smoke coming from beneath the vehicle. The contact pulled over and turned off the vehicle, and it caught fire. The origin of the fire was unknown. The location of the fire was the front of the vehicle and the contact stated that the fire extinguished itself. A fire department report was not available. The vehicle was towed to a tow yard. The contact had received notification of NHTSA Campaign Number: 22V626000 (Trailer Hitches). The manufacturer was not yet made aware of the failure. The approximate failure mileage was 80,000.
